報告題目:SHPB脆性材料測試中的偽應變率效應研究
Title:Structural effects on the measurement of dynamic strength of brittle materials using SHPB

摘要:報告將介紹近十年來關于結構對脆性材料動態強度影響的系統研究。目前使用的基于SHPB的動態測量方法嚴重高估了脆性材料的動強度,在數值模型中錯誤地使用了許多基于SHPB測量的經驗公式。報告還將討論獲得脆性材料動態強度的有效應變率效應的可能途徑,以及對脆性材料動態強度產生真正應變率效應的機理。
Abstract:This presentation introduces a systematic research over past decade about the structural effects on the dynamic strength of brittle materials. The currently-used dynamic measurement method based on SHPB seriously over-calculate the dynamic strength of brittle materials, and many empirical equations based on SHPB measurements are used wrongly in the numerical models. Possible ways to obtain valid strain-rate effect on the dynamic strength of brittle materials and the mechanisms that produce genuine strain-rate effects on the dynamic strength of brittle materials will also be discussed.
簡介:李慶明教授,1982年北京大學本科畢業,1986年北京大學研究生畢業獲碩士學位,1997年于University of Liverpool獲得哲學博士及機械工程博士(DEng),英國機械工程師協會會士(Fellow of Institute of Mechanical Engineers)及注冊工程師(CE)。現為英國曼徹斯特大學應用力學教授及沖擊爆炸實驗室主任。他的研究領域包括結構耐撞性、侵徹力學、固體材料的動態行為、結構保護、多孔固體力學、沖擊環境和安全。他目前是國際防護結構協會(IAPS)和國際沖擊工程學會(ISIE)的理事會成員。自2008年以來,他一直擔任“國際沖擊工程雜志”的副主編,并擔任其他幾家雜志的編委會成員。
Introduction: Prof. Qingming Li is currently a professor in applied mechanics at The University of Manchester, and leads the impact and explosion laboratory. He graduated from Peking University with BSc and MSc and from University of Liverpool with Ph.D and a higher doctorate (Doctor of Engineer, DEng). His research field covers structural crashworthiness, penetration mechanics, dynamic behavior of solid materials, structural protection, mechanics of cellular solids, shock environment and safety. He is currently the board members of International Association of Protective Structures (IAPS) and International Society of Impact Engineering (ISIE). He is a charted engineer (CE) and a fellow of Institute of Mechanical Engineer (FIMechE). He has been the associate editor of International Journal of Impact Engineering since 2008 and editorial board members of several other journals.
